新型无机-有机杂化化合物NH_(4)[Cu_(3)^(I)(C_(10)H_(8)N_(2))_(3)Mo_(8)O_(26)]的合成、结构及性能

摘  要:水热法合成了一个无机-有机杂化的NH_(4)[Cu_(3)^(I)(C_(10)H_(8)N_(2))_(3)Mo_(8)O_(26)]化合物,通过元素分析和单晶X-射线衍射进行了表征。化合物为三斜晶系,P1空间群,晶胞参数a=1.08763(9)nm,b=1.12674(10)nm,c=1.13067(10)nm,α=68.4820(10)°,β=83.523(2)°,γ=64.4180(10)°,V=1.16095(2)nm^(3),Z=1,Dc=2.661 g/cm^(3),Mr=1860.73,μ(MoKα)=35.22 cm^(-1),F(000)=888,R=0.0478,wR=0.099。化合物的结构包含2个结晶学上独立的铜原子、不连续的多氧阴离子β-[Mo_(8)O_(2)6]4-和无限扩展的[Cu I(C_(10)H_(8)N_(2))]链。每一个铜原子为类似的{CuN_(2)}配位模式,被4,4’-联吡啶连接成一维沿a轴方向的[Cu(C 10 H 8 N 2)]+链。分子结构中存在氢键和π…π作用。对化合物的热稳定性、荧光性质也进行了研究。A hybrid compound,NH_(4)[Cu^(I)_(3)(C_(10)H_(8)N_(2))_(3)Mo_(8)O_(26)](1),has been hydrothermally synthesized and structurally characterized by elemental analysis and single crystal X-ray analysis.The compound crystallizes in triclinic,space group P1 with a=1.08763(9)nm,b=1.12674(10)nm,c=1.13067(10)nm,α=68.4820(10)°,β=83.523(2)°,γ=64.4180(10)°,V=1.16095(2)nm^(3),Z=1,Dc=2.661 g/cm^(3),Mr=1860.73,μ(MoKα)=35.22 cm^(-1),F(000)=888,R=0.0478,wR=0.099.The structure is composed of discrete polyoxoanionβ-[Mo_(8)O_(2)6]4-and infinite[Cu I(C_(10)H_(8)N_(2))]chains with two crystallographically independent copper atoms.Each of two copper atoms exhibits similar{CuN_(2)}coordination mode,and is linked by 4,4’-bipyridine molecule to one-dimensional[Cu(C_(10)H_(8)N_(2))]+chain along the a axis.There exists hydrogen bonds andπ…πinteractions in the molecular structure.Moreover,the thermal stability and photoluminescence property are studied as well.

关 键 词:多氧阴离子 β-[Mo 8 O 26]4-  晶体结构 水热合成 热稳定性 荧光性能
